Here's Which Stores Will Be Closed (and Open) on Thanksgiving Day 2021

The COVID-19 pandemic changed holiday shopping in 2020 with many retailers closing their doors on Thanksgiving and Americans opting for online shopping and contactless pick-up.

As Americans gear up for the holiday season this year, here’s a look at what retailers will be open (and closed) on Thanksgiving. 

Target – Closed

Walmart – Closed 

Best Buy – Closed

Costco – Closed

Home Depot — Closed

Macy’s – Closed 

DICK’S Sporting Goods — Closed

Aldi — Closed

Marshalls – Closed 

Trader Joe’s – Closed

JCPenney – Closed

Kohl’s – Closed

Barnes and Noble – Closed 

Bed Bath and Beyond – Closed

Old Navy – Closed 

Whole Foods – Open for modified hours (check your store here)

Kroger – Check with local store

Big Lots – Open 7 a.m. to 9 p.m.

Lowe’s – Closed

Foot Locker – Closed

Bloomingdale’s – Closed

Nordstrom – Closed

Nordstrom Rack – Closed

Office Depot – Closed

OfficeMax – Closed

PetCo – Closed

REI – Closed

Sam’s Club – Closed

Staples – Closed

This list will be updated as more stores release holiday hours.
